A new series begins from the artist of the Eisner-nominated Wandering Island! The year is 1967, and a young Japanese man is thinking about the future. On one side of the water, the war is raging in Vietnam; far away on the other side, the Apollo Project has just met with disaster as three astronauts die in a capsule fire. And here and now, on a long nighttime ferry ride back home, he will meet and fall in love with a mysterious young woman who carries a past deeper and more profound than his dreams and fears of tomorrow. Her name, she jokes, is no name--Emanon...and she can never be forgotten, any more than she can forget...

Emanon's wanderings across late-1960s Japan bring her across other lives in small country towns, with each encounter leaving people transformed in her wake. Yet when love once again leads to pregnancy and the start of a new cycle in Emanon's birth and rebirth, she is confronted with something she has never before borne: twins, one of them, for the first time, a boy. Will he too grow up to inherit her immortal memories, as all her daughters have before? Vol. 2 of four.

Mikura Amelia, following her clues and research, sets her floatplane down in the Pacific, waiting for the drifting passage of Electric Island. No sooner does it appear than her GPS goes out...so where is she, and the island, headed? The sun-baked maze of streets and buildings that make up Electric Island is curious and charming...which is more than can be said for its sullen inhabitants who will barely communicate with Mikura. Did they fall prey to the same enigma that drew Mikura here...and will she recognize the people from her past when she finds them...?
